Anzick-1's skeletal remains included 28 cranial fragments, the left clavicle, and several ribs. These bones were discovered in highly fragmented states; however, partial reconstruction of the crania allowed for age estimation, investigation of basic health indicators, and some information about cultural practices. Originally, investigators thought the left clavicle showed evidence of cremation, but further analysis revealed that the discoloration was the result of groundwater staining and not fire. Additionally, all of the Anzick-1 remains were stained with ocher, which masks the natural color of the infant's bones.
The age at death of an individual can be determined from several skeletal markers, including cranial suture closure, tooth eruption rates, rates of epiphyseal fusion on long bones, and others. Cranial bones fuse together along suture lines throughout the life of every human, and can be used to estimate the age at death of human remains. The small size and lack of suture closure of Anzick-1's crania revealed that the individual was 1–2 years old. The metopic suture is also present in the frontal bone of Anzick-1.

Profile of a Neanderthal skull, with the occipital bun visible at the back of the skull Occipital bun on a modern human male An occipital bun, also called occipital spurs, occipital knob, chignon hooks or inion hooks, is a prominent bulge or projection of the occipital bone at the back of the skull. It is important in scientific descriptions of classic Neanderthal crania. While common among many of humankind's ancestors, primarily robust relatives rather than gracile, the protrusion is still relatively prevalent in modern Homo sapiens. It is suspected that occipital buns might correlate with the biomechanics of running.

Evidence of human occupation at Gobero started during the Early Holocene dating around 7550 BCE to 6250 BCE (9500 to 8200 BP). The Early Holocene occupation is associated with the Kiffian culture: they were tall (as much as 6-foot 8-inches). According to Sereno (2008), "Their crania were long and low and are characterized by a distinct occipital bun, flattened sagittal profile, pentagonal posterior outline, broad proportions across the zygoma and interorbital region, broad nasal aperture, and negligible alveolar prognathism." They were heavily muscled hunter-fishers, they left a distinctive pottery with wavy lines and probably remained in the region until around 6000 BCE.

Although the maker of CranID does not explicitly state that this program can infer ‘race’, many forensic anthropologists use this program, and others like it, to determine the race of an unknown individual, even though many biological anthropologists have criticized the use of the concept. A study conducted on the CranID program found that while the program is "supposed to allocate an individual skull to a specific population rather than a ‘major race’," the program did not generate persuasive allocations of individual crania to a geographical population. Another criticism is the fact that many of the measurements that are essential to this program are subject to both interobserver error and intraobserver error. Measurements between researchers can vary substantially in size and that this degree of variation in measurements can have a striking effect on the results of CranID.

38–41 In Morton's Crania Americana, his claims were based on Craniometry data, that the Caucasians had the biggest brains, averaging 87 cubic inches, Native Americans were in the middle with an average of 82 cubic inches and Negroes had the smallest brains with an average of 78 cubic inches.Illustration from Types of Mankind (1854), whose authors leftIn The Mismeasure of Man (1981), the evolutionary biologist and historian of science Stephen Jay Gould argued that Samuel Morton had falsified the craniometric data, perhaps inadvertently over-packing some skulls, to so produce results that would legitimize the racist presumptions he was attempting to prove. A subsequent study by the anthropologist John Michael found Morton's original data to be more accurate than Gould describes, concluding that "[c]ontrary to Gould's interpretation... Morton's research was conducted with integrity". Jason Lewis and colleagues reached similar conclusions as Michael in their reanalysis of Morton's skull collection; however, they depart from Morton's racist conclusions by adding that "studies have demonstrated that modern human variation is generally continuous, rather than discrete or "racial," and that most variation in modern humans is within, rather than between, populations".
Some of Jantz’s more current research involves quantitative osteometric and anthropometric variation among Native American populations, including an analysis of the work of Franz Boas. In the early 1900s, Boas conducted an anthropometric study showing the plasticity of the human body in response to environmental changes. Testing the skeletal measurements of children of immigrants to the US, he found that their measurements were closer to the American mean than to the mean of their home countries. Boas saw this as an argument that nutrition and environment was more important in determining body measurements than racial background, and his study was widely seen as discrediting racial anthropometry. In 2002, Jantz conducted a reassessment of Boas' study, the first time anyone had examined the validity of Boas’ work. Specimens from Jantz’s research ranged in age from 10,000 years old to the modern period. In his reassessment, Jantz argued that Boas’ original claims about the variations in skeletal plasticity between European and American born children was flawed, stating that he could find only insignificant differences between European and American born children. He also argued that exposure to the environment in America did not affect the children's crania.
